Central Washington University Board of Trustees October 19, 2023
EXECUTIVE SUMMARY – Climate Change Action Plan Central Washington University’s Sustainability Officer, Jeff Bousson, will be providing a high-level overview of our draft institutional Climate Change Action Plan. For the past several months, Jeff has collaborated with the campus and local community to identify, develop, and prioritize strategies that will enable CWU to achieve 45% greenhouse gas emission reductions by 2030. Before CWU’s Climate Change Action Plan is completed in February 2024, Jeff is seeking input and guidance from the campus community, including the Board of Trustees, to generate support and ownership of the goals, strategies, and action steps listed within the Plan. Jeff will provide insight on CWU’s current climate footprint, the progress already occurring on campus, and the process for infusing community feedback as we shape a more sustainable and decarbonized future for our university. Additionally, Jeff will share the overarching goals, key pillars, and focus areas of the draft Climate Change Action Plan as well as our approach to implementing sustainability initiatives and climate pollution reduction strategies at CWU for many years to come.
